Death row inmate becomes third person to die from new execution method described as 'torture'

Carey Dale Grayson was killed with the torturous method on Thursday 21 November, 30 years after his heinous crime

A death row inmate became the third ever person to be executed with a new method, which is said to be brutal.

American prisoner Carey Dale Grayson was held at the William C. Holman Correctional facility in Alabama, after he was found guilty of killing and mutilating a mother while she was hitchhiking back in 1994.

He was just a teenager when he carried out the heinous act, and along with three other teens, they offered her a car ride as she was making her way back to West Monroe, Louisiana, from Chattanooga, Tennessee.

Prosecutors stated that the group took Vickie DeBlieux to a wooded area, assaulted her, and beat her.

It was so brutal in fact, that a medical examiner revealed that DeBlieux's face was so severely fractured that she could only be identified through an X-ray of her spine.

The teenagers became suspects after one showed a friend a photo of one of the mother's severed fingers, bragging about the killing.

It is believed that they threw her off a cliff and returned to mutilate her body, stabbing her a total of 180 times.

He was the only teen to face a death sentence, as the rest of them were under 18 at the time of the crime, while he was 19.

But on 21 November this year, Grayson, now 50, was executed after consuming his final meal, a selection of Mexican food with some Mountain Dew Blast.

He was executed via nitrogen gas hypoxia, meaning he would die from oxygen deprivation.

Grayson became the third ever person in the US to die this way, in a method that has been compared to 'torture'.

It works by putting a gas mask on someone's face, replacing breathable air with nitrogen as the criminal suffocates.

When asked by the prison governor if he had any final words, Grayson spat at him, saying: "For you, you need to f*** off."

The 50-year-old showed him both of his middle fingers as he was fed a wave of nitrogen gas, choking him and killing him, and he was pronounced dead at 6.33pm.

Alabama only introduced nitrogen gas as an execution method earlier this year, and Grayson's death came just hours after his request for a stay was denied by the US Supreme Court.

Grayson's legal team said that the method needed further examination before being administered again.

Directly following the execution on Thursday, Governor Kay Ivey said that she was praying for Deblieux's loved ones to heal and find closure, following 30 years of pain.

She stated: "Some thirty years ago, Vicki DeBlieux's journey to her mother's house and ultimately, her life, were horrifically cut short because of Carey Grayson and three other men.

"She sensed something was wrong, attempted to escape, but instead, was brutally tortured and murdered," Ivey said.

Describing Grayson's crimes, she went on: "(They were) heinous, unimaginable, without an ounce of regard for human life and just unexplainably mean. An execution by nitrogen hypoxia (bears) no comparison to the death and dismemberment Ms. DeBlieux experienced."
